顺铣和逆铣的编程主要区别在于刀具的切削速度方向与工件的移动方向是否相同。以下是具体的编程方法:
顺铣
定义:刀具的切削速度方向与工件的移动方向相同。
编程方法:
铣削工件外轮廓时,沿工件外轮廓顺时针方向进给、编程即为顺铣。
铣削工件内轮廓时,沿工件内轮廓逆时针方向进给、编程即为顺铣。
逆铣
定义:刀具的切削速度方向与工件的移动方向相反。
编程方法:
铣削工件外轮廓时,沿工件外轮廓逆时针方向进给、编程即为逆铣。
铣削工件内轮廓时,沿工件内轮廓顺时针方向进给、编程即为逆铣。
示例
假设我们要铣削一个外轮廓,工件尺寸为100mm x 100mm,刀具直径为20mm,我们希望采用顺铣的方式进行加工。
顺铣编程:
```
% 外轮廓顺铣
G01 X100 Y100
G02 I-50 J50 F100
G01 X0 Y0
```
`G01`:直线插补,移动到起始点 (100, 100)。
`G02`:顺时针圆弧插补,半径为50mm,速度为100mm/min。
`G01`:直线插补,回到原点 (0, 0)。
逆铣编程:
```
% 外轮廓逆铣
G01 X100 Y100
G02 I50 J-50 F100
G01 X0 Y0
```
`G01`:直线插补,移动到起始点 (100, 100)。
`G02`:逆时针圆弧插补,半径为50mm,速度为100mm/min。
`G01`:直线插补,回到原点 (0, 0)。
建议
选择合适的铣削方式:根据工件的形状和加工要求选择顺铣或逆铣,以达到最佳的加工效果和刀具寿命。
注意切削参数:合理设置切削速度、进给量和切削深度,以减少刀具磨损和工件变形。
编程时注意方向:在编程时务必注意刀具的切削速度方向和工件的移动方向,以确保编程的正确性。